Purpose of use

We use account and device details to provide sign-in, protect account access, investigate unusual activity and respond to support requests. Payment references from DANA, OVO, GoPay, QRIS, BCA, BRI, Mandiri or BNI help us check a transaction status without requesting secret wallet credentials.

Cookies and storage

Cookies and similar storage can keep a session active, remember a language or help the mobile path open at the right point. You can manage browser storage through your device settings, although changing it may require another sign-in before the lobby loads.

Account security

Phone verification, sign-in records and device signals help us identify account activity that does not match your normal path. If you see an unfamiliar session, contact support without sharing a password. We may ask account questions before changing access or discussing records.

Retention choices

We retain information only while it supports the stated account, security, payment-status or legal purpose, subject to applicable requirements. A deletion request does not always remove records that must remain for a transaction check or legal obligation, and we explain that outcome to you.

Requesting changes

You can ask for a copy, correction, restriction or deletion of information through the policy contact path. Tell us which account detail needs attention, such as a phone number or wallet reference. We verify the request before making a change to protect your account.
